So, 'Love Apptually' is this intriguing exploration of modern romance, diving deep into the world of Tinder. You’ve got this French journalist, right? He starts off all starry-eyed about the app, but as he digs into its algorithm, things get real. The tone is kind of introspective, laced with a bit of humor and a touch of melancholy. It’s not just about dating; it touches on themes of connection and the pitfalls of technology in relationships. The pacing feels unhurried, allowing you to really soak in the thoughts and revelations. Plus, there’s this unique blend of practical effects and real-life interviews that gives it an authentic feel. It's distinct in its approach to a topic that's often glossed over in cinema.
